16 #ifndef OpenGl_Cylinder_Header
17 #define OpenGl_Cylinder_Header
19 #include <OpenGl_Quadric.hxx>
21 //! Tool class for generating cylinder tessellation of quadric surface.
22 class OpenGl_Cylinder : public OpenGl_Quadric
26 //! Create undefined cylinder primitive.
27 Standard_EXPORT OpenGl_Cylinder();
29 //! Initialize cylinder primitive.
30 Standard_EXPORT Standard_Boolean Init (const Standard_ShortReal theBotRad,
31 const Standard_ShortReal theTopRad,
32 const Standard_ShortReal theHeight,
33 const Standard_Integer theNbSlices = 10,
34 const Standard_Integer theNbStacks = 10);
38 //! Returns surface point for the given parameters.
39 Standard_EXPORT virtual OpenGl_Vec3 evalVertex (const Standard_ShortReal theU,
40 const Standard_ShortReal theV) const Standard_OVERRIDE;
42 //! Returns surface normal for the given parameters.
43 Standard_EXPORT virtual OpenGl_Vec3 evalNormal (const Standard_ShortReal theU,
44 const Standard_ShortReal theV) const Standard_OVERRIDE;
48 Standard_ShortReal myBotRad; //!< Radius of the cylinder at bottom
49 Standard_ShortReal myTopRad; //!< Radius of the cylinder at top
50 Standard_ShortReal myHeight; //!< Height of the cylinder
54 #endif // OpenGl_Cylinder_Header
